顶峰山矿区水文地质特征与防治水措施

摘    要: 顶峰山矿井地下水系统包括第四系孔隙含水岩组、煤系基岩裂隙含水岩组、栖霞灰岩裂隙-岩溶含水岩组和老空水;矿井充水水源有大气降水、含水岩组、断裂构造带和老窑积水,其中对矿井有突水危险的主要是导水性断层和老窑积水;由于矿井内发育的导水性断层为岩溶水进入煤系提供了通道,防治水的重点工作是探查导水性断层和老窑积水区,导水性断层的探查主要采用高分辨率三维地震勘探和瞬变电磁法相结合的探测方法;防治方法可根据实际情况采用留设防隔水煤(岩)柱、截流堵水、疏水降压和注浆加固等措施;老窑积水主要分布在F5断层以北地区,采取钻探与物探相结合的方法进行探查,主要防治方法为留设防水煤岩柱和探放水。

Hydrogeological Features and Measures for Water Control in Dingfengshan Mine

Abstract:The groundwater system in Dingfengshan Mine includes quaternary pore aquifer group,fissure aquifer group of coal bed rock,fissure-karst aquifer group of Qixia limestone,and goaf water;the water in the system is generated from atmospheric precipitation,aquifer group,faulted structural belt,and goaf water,among them the faulted structural belt and goaf water are the major risks for the mine water inrush.The hydraulic conductivity of faulted structural belt,which is originated with in the mine,allows karst wat...
